Each year in the United States the celebration of National Hispanic Heritage Month takes place from Sept. 15 to Oct. 15 by honoring the histories, cultures and contributions of community members who originate or whose ancestors came from Spain, Mexico, the Caribbean, Central and South America and other Spanish-speaking countries. The observation started in 1968 under President Lyndon Johnson as Hispanic Heritage Week and was expanded by President Ronald Reagan in 1988 to cover a 30-day period starting on Sept. 15 and ending on Oct. 15.

Celebratory events in Bloomington include:

• Monroe County Public Library along with La Casa/Latino Cultural Center-Indiana University and El Centro Comunal Latino are co-sponsoring the opening ceremony of National Hispanic Heritage Month on Sept. 14, 2013 from noon to 4 p.m. at the Monroe County Public Library. (303 E. Kirkwood Ave., Bloomington) For more information contact Daniel Soto at 349.3465 or sotod@bloomington.in.gov

• The 8th Annual Fiesta del Otoño fall cultural festival will take place on Saturday, Sept. 21, 2013 from 10 a.m. to 12 p.m. at the Bloomington Farmers' Market (City Hall, 401 N. Morton St., Bloomington). Local Latino artists and community members from many different Latin American, Caribbean and Spanish-speaking countries will showcase their traditions and talents through food, dance, music, activities for kids and much more. For more information contact Prisma Lopez-Marin at 349.3464 or lopezp@bloomington.in.gov

• The ¡HOLA Bloomington! Spanish language radio show will run weekly specials highlighting the contributions of Latinos to our community and to the country. The show airs every Friday from 6 to 7 p.m. on WFHB 91.3 FM. For more information contact Lylian Martinez at 349.3860 or martinel@bloomington.in.gov

The 8th Annual Fiesta del Otoño celebration is brought to you by the City of Bloomington Community and Family Resources Department with friendly support from El Centro Comunal Latino and the Commission on Hispanic/Latino Affairs.
